About the role

We are looking for a visionary Head of PR who lives and breathes storytelling. Someone who can blend creativity with data and lead a talented PR team to shape how the world sees MacPaw and our products. We are building an ambitious, AI-first ecosystem that will expand what people can do and help them achieve more. You will be in charge of establishing and executing our communications strategy.

Location: Boston, MA.

Responsibilities

  • Shape the narrative - develop and execute a comprehensive global PR strategy for MacPaw and our products, aligning it with the company’s long-term vision and business goals.
  • Build meaningful connections - cultivate strategic relationships with TIER-1 tech media, global journalists, and industry partners to expand MacPaw’s footprint.
  • Lead with data - define a unified reporting architecture and KPIs for PR. Use data-driven insights to measure success, optimize campaigns, and prove impact.
  • Own the stage - identify, organize, and leverage key industry events globally to boost MacPaw’s recognition and build strong industry ties.
  • Be the guardian of our reputation - oversee our public image across key global markets, crafting clear messaging and proactively managing reputational risks.
  • Innovate with AI - drive the integration of AI tools within our PR workflows, establishing high-level frameworks to make our communications faster, smarter, and more efficient.
  • Manage resources - oversee PR budget planning and allocation to ensure maximum impact and operational excellence.
  • Empower the team - mentor, coach, and grow a team of talented PR professionals. Set clear goals, foster accountability, and support their career journeys.

Requirements

  • 5+ years of experience in corporate brand marketing or PR, with a strong background in the global tech industry.
  • Proven experience in building successful global PR campaigns.
  • Deep understanding of media relations.
  • Solid understanding of consumer behavior and the ability to turn data into actionable strategies.
  • Exceptional collaboration and communication skills, with a natural ability to work cross-functionally and inspire people.
  • Proven experience managing a high-performing PR team.

Nice-to-have

  • Hands-on experience using LLMs and AI agents to supercharge your daily workflows.
  • Understanding of Generative Engine Optimization (GEO) and how AI search is changing the future of PR.
